Albian CAL4, Firebag CFG6, Horizon CYNR, Mildred Lake CER4, and Muskeg Tower CFW4 in Alberta Canada Download

Images related to this file:

File Description:
All of these airfields are in or close to the Athabasca Tar Sands in Alberta, modelled here along with the airfields. The tar sands workings extend along the Athabasca River for over 60 miles north of Fort McMurray in northern Alberta, and the huge cleared areas, surface mining, tailings ponds, and refineries along the Athabasca are right up there as Alberta's biggest VFR landmark. One look at a tailings pond (sea? ocean?) makes it clear that someone was worried about public reaction to the size. As well as the surface mining there are also large areas where there is underground extraction with a grid of dirt tracks between equipment installations. There are four airfields associated with the tar sands. Horizon CYNR is a public service airport operated by Canadian Natural Reources Ltd. Mildred Lake CER4 is owned and operated by Syncrude. Albian CAL4 is owned and operated by Shell Canada, and Firebag CFG6 is owned and operated by Suncor Energy. The fifth airfield is the nearby Muskeg Tower CFW4, which is there solely to support folks during their fire watch in the 120 feet tall tower. There is also a sixth airfield east of Horizon across the river and still visible, Bitumount; this is no longer in use. Woodward Field Airport KCDN Download

Images related to this file:

File Description:
Woodward Field Airport is a county-owned public-use general aviation airport. It is sometimes called Kershaw County Airport, and many people also know it as the Camden Airport. It is located approx. 6.9 miles northeast of the historical city of Camden, South Carolina and currently does not serve scheduled airline flights. It is host to several vintage aircraft events and fly-in's annually. PMDY - Midway Island (1970) Download

Images related to this file:

File Description:
FS2004 scenery for Midway Island (1970). Midway Island has long been a vital stopover for ships and aircraft plying the Central Pacific. Although the islands are a quiet nature preserve today, during the 1970s Midway was a key link in the DEW (Detection Early Warning) radar defense system. Midway Island is actually two islands; Sand Island (the Western Island) with the current airfield and Eastern Island with an airfield dating from World War II which has become an antennae farm.
